Minecraft On New Nintendo 3DS Updated To Include Local Multiplayer Mode

The team over at Mojang and Microsoft have announced that Minecraft on the New Nintendo 3DS has been updated today to include local multiplayer. This means you can team up with a friend locally and play Minecraft together to your heart’s content. Minecraft is available now only on the New Nintendo 3DS.
